I am translating a hotel brochure into English. Please advise which of the following would be more appropriate and sound natural:
1. Please note that all purchases shall be settled at check out.
2. Please note that consumption will be charged upon check-out.

All other incidentals to be paid upon check out
another option
-------------------
Incidentals – Charges to the guests room other than room and tax such as telephone usage, room service, pay movies, etc.
http://www.landcormeetings.com/term.htm
Incidentals - personal items such as dry cleaning, telephone calls, bar bills and miscellaneous items excluded from the price of a tour.
http://www.caltia.com/education/terms.html
Pre-paid rooms: Hotels will collect incidentals such as meals, car parking and telephone calls separately at time of check-out.

all purchases will be settled
consumption is inappropriate because more than just food can be settled with a hotel bill, especially in larger hotels

all accounts are to be settled upon check out
this is, I think, the usual way to express this in a hotal context
(accounts are settled, purchases completed or made)
